AI Summary
-
Courts may order wireless telephone providers to transfer billing responsibility and rights to a phone number to domestic violence or stalking victims upon issuance of a final or permanent restraining order, if the victim is not the account holder.
-
The court may also order the defendant to reimburse the victim for any fees incurred during the transfer of billing responsibilities.
-
Wireless providers must notify the victim and court within 72 hours if they cannot complete the transfer due to technical limitations, such as account termination or network incompatibility.
-
Upon transfer, the victim assumes all financial responsibility for the phone number, monthly service costs, and any associated mobile devices.
-
Wireless providers and their employees are granted liability protection for actions taken in compliance with court orders issued under this law.
Legislative Description
Permits court to order transfer of billing responsibility for, and rights to, wireless telephone number to certain victims of domestic violence or stalking.
